When we took over Sayulita in October of 2024, we weren’t sure what we had. Sure it had a good run for a couple years before Covid, but like a lot of restaurants, they never really recovered post-Covid. The concept was tired and it was time to wake the place up and figure out what we wanted to be.
So we did what we did at our other five restaurants in an attempt to figure it out. We threw stuff against the wall to see if it worked and screwed up a few things, somehow getting even worse before finally getting better. It’s quite the process, one we’ve somehow successfully executed several times before.
In the end, our concept evolved away from the original vision of Sayulita. Gone was the traditional Mexican fare and Latin music replaced by Tex Mex and Country with a focus on Tacos. We added a bar and instituted full service as opposed to prior counter service. We created a place where we hoped everyone would feel welcome.
And we think the transformation worked. Based on the increase in business and improved customer feedback, it appears you do as well. Thank you for your support and we hope you’ll say hello to Say Taco for years to come.
